Bitcoin Miner Rewards Shrink Below Pre-Halving Levels as Network Fees Fall Sharply

Bitcoin Miner Rewards Shrink Below Pre-Halving Levels as Network Fees Fall SharplyAfter experiencing a period of high fees, onchain transfer costs on the Bitcoin network have decreased significantly. On Friday, the fees peaked at $240 per transaction, but by now they have fallen to just $11.06 each. Bitcoin Makes Progress in Clearing Backlog, but Lightning Network Capacity and Channels Dropped Amid Congestion

Bitcoin Makes Progress in Clearing Backlog, but Lightning Network Capacity and Channels Dropped Amid CongestionIn the past week, the Bitcoin network has made progress in resolving its congestion issues. On May 7, 2023, the number of unconfirmed transactions reached an all-time high of over 500,000 transfers, causing a major backlog. However, as of today, that number has been reduced to 263,406. Arbitrum’s Daily Transaction Count Surpasses Ethereum for the First Time Ever

Arbitrum’s Daily Transaction Count Surpasses Ethereum for the First Time EverAccording to statistics recorded this week on Tuesday and Wednesday, the layer two scaling project Arbitrum’s transaction count has surpassed Ethereum’s. On Wednesday, Arbitrum processed 1,090,510 transactions, compared to Ethereum’s 1,080,839 transfer count. Combined Transactions on Arbitrum and Optimism L2 Chains Outpace Ethereum’s Daily Transfer Count 

Combined Transactions on Arbitrum and Optimism L2 Chains Outpace Ethereum’s Daily Transfer Count Since The Merge, Ethereum’s onchain fees have been considerably lower. However, combined transaction volume on layer two (L2) chains Arbitrum and Optimism has outpaced Ethereum’s onchain transaction output.
